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Patients who meet all of the following criteria will be included in the study 1) Thymic carcinoma confirmed by histological diagnosis. 2) Unresectable Masaoka stage III or higher disease, or recurrence after surgical resection and/or definitive (chemo)radiotherapy. 3) Advanced or recurrent disease diagnosed between April 1, 2000 and December 31, 2023. 4) Receipt of at least one of the following treatments: local therapy (palliative surgery or radiotherapy) and/or systemic chemotherapy.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Patients who meet any of the following criteria will be excluded from the study; 1) Cases deemed inappropriate for inclusion by the researchers.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Epidemiological assessment 1) The prevalence of oligometastatic disease in patients with advanced or recurrent thymic carcinoma, as well as patterns of metastasis (metastatic organs and number of metastatic lesions) 2) The frequency and types of local therapy administered for oligometastatic disease Prognostic evaluation Overall survival (comparison between patients who received local therapy and those who did not) |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Efficacy and safety of first line treatment Progression free survival (PFS), objective response rate (ORR), disease control rate (DCR), and incidence of adverse events In patients who underwent local therapy Efficacy and safety of local therapy PFS, ORR, DCR, and incidence of adverse events Efficacy and safety of systemic therapy before and after local therapy PFS, ORR, DCR, and incidence of adverse events | — |
